What affects the price

When you are looking at a new HVAC setup, the final number depends on a few moving parts. The physical size of your home and the necessary ductwork adjustments play a huge role. We also look at the efficiency ratings of the unit; higher efficiency models often cost more upfront but can change your monthly utility bills. Other factors include the type of fuel your home uses, specific brand preferences, and any modifications needed to your existing electrical system. It is best to look at these as investments in your comfort.

About this service

Furnace installation involves removing your old heating unit and setting up a new system that safely integrates with your home's gas or electric lines. You need this service when your furnace is nearing the end of its lifespan or you notice inconsistent heating throughout your home. We focus on proper venting and safety protocols to ensure your family stays warm and secure all winter.
